Dell V105

I'd like to know if it is possible to install my Dell V105 printer on an Arch Linux guest machine in VMware Player running on Windows Vista Home Basic 32-bit edition with Service Pack 2. In the guest, I've installed CUPS, Ghostscript, and SANE. What's next?

Re: Dell V105

Where is that printer installed, i.e. is it attached somehow to the Windows machine and does it work on Windows? I have no experience with VMWare and so don't know if it can provide the printer as a local printer to guests, but I guess one possible option would be to use it in Arch as a network printer. You first need to find the IP address of the Windows machine and see if you can reach that IP address from within your Arch guest. You would then go through the CUPS configuration and configure it as a normal network printer (lpd://).
